
NBCZ_Admin_NetCore: Asp.Net Core + Dapper + Vue + IView 的前后端分离通用权限系统...
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
NBCZ_Admin_NetCore是一款基于Asp.Net Core框架结合Dapper轻量级数据映射组件,前端采用Vue和IView的现代化前后端分离架构的企业级通用权限管理系统。
一、框架概述
NBCZ_Admin_NetCore 是一个前后端分离的通用权限系统,使用 Visual Studio 2017 和 SQL Server 2012 开发工具构建而成。后端采用标准三层架构:基于 .NET Standard 2.0 标准类库。数据访问层(Repository)利用 Dapper.Contrib 和 Dapper 实现。API 部分则使用 ASP.NET Core Web API 并结合 JWT 身份验证机制。前端部分则是基于 Vue 框架的 iView 组件。
二、配置与使用
项目文件的基本配置:
1. 使用 git 克隆项目。
2. 修改文件夹及解决方案(sln)、项目文件(csproj)和用户相关文件名称,使其对应项目的命名空间。
3. 在 sln 和 csproj 文件中将 NBCZ 替换为项目的命名空间。
4. 用 Visual Studio 打开项目后,替换整个解决方案中的 NBCZ 以匹配新的命名空间。
数据库配置:
1. 还原数据库 db 到 NBCZ。
2. 修改 DBUtility 项目下的 DbEntity.ttinclude 文件。
全部评论 (0)
还没有任何评论哟~


